@adyen/adyen-web
Version:
[](https://www.npmjs.com/package/@adyen/adyen-web)
3 lines (2 loc) • 621 B
JavaScript
import{isEmpty as e}from"../../../utils/validator-utils.js";import{ERROR_FIELD_REQUIRED as r}from"../../../core/Errors/constants.js";import{validationRules as l}from"../../../utils/Validator/defaultRules.js";const a={default:{validate:e=>e&&e.length>0,errorMessage:r,modes:["blur"]},firstName:{validate:r=>!e(r)||null,errorMessage:"firstName.invalid",modes:["blur"]},lastName:{validate:r=>!e(r)||null,errorMessage:"lastName.invalid",modes:["blur"]},dateOfBirth:l.dateOfBirthRule,telephoneNumber:l.phoneNumberRule,shopperEmail:l.emailRule};export{a as personalDetailsValidationRules};
//# sourceMappingURL=validate.js.map